
JIAN CENTER FOR WOMEN: PRESERVING DIGNITY OF WOMEN AND GIRLS IN BAHIRKE AND SHEKHAN
Timeline: February 2015 – April 2015 Project Objective: Provide GBV survivors with psychosocial counseling and referral services, and provide awareness on self protection mechanisms against the many forms of GBV. Project Description: In both Bahirke and Shekhan, Psycho-social support was Read More

WRO Distributes School Items to Orphanage
WRO made a visit to the orphanage to examine the situation of teenage girls and to investigate their needs. Based on the needs visit, we secured clothing and school stationary for the girls and boys. [tribulant_slideshow gallery_id="5"]

JIAN CENTER FOR WOMEN: PSYCHOSOCIAL AND PROTECTION
Timeline: October 2014 – December 2014 Project Objective: Reduce vulnerability of Iraqi IDPs fleeing from Sinjar and Nineveh plains through ensuring access and a referral system including counseling and psychosocial support services for women and adolescents girls among IDPs and Read More
